Can GeForce GTX 1060 run Kraken?
GreatThe GeForce GTX 1060 handles Kraken well at 1080p, delivering approximately 83 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 63 FPS.
Kraken – GeForce GTX 1060 FPS Data
| Quality | 1080p | 1440p | 4K |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 130 fps | 98 fps | 52 fps |
| Medium | 104 fps | 78 fps | 42 fps |
| High | 83 fps | 63 fps | 33 fps |
| Ultra | 68 fps | 51 fps | 27 fps |
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

About
"Kraken," released in 2017, is an action-packed indie game that lets players take control of the legendary sea monster, the Kraken. Dive into a world of high-seas chaos as you maneuver through and obliterate historical nautical empires, combining thrilling gameplay with a unique premise. This blend of action and exploration within a retro-inspired aesthetic makes "Kraken" a standout in the indie gaming scene.
When it comes to PC performance, "Kraken" is quite accessible, with a minimum requirement of an entry-level GPU, scoring around 9638 to ensure smooth gameplay. Players will find it runs well on a variety of systems, given its specifications of only 8 GB RAM and modest graphics settings. For optimal FPS, a mid-tier GPU is recommended, allowing for a more visually striking experience while maintaining fluid performance during intense action sequences.
